作者lonelytea (霸氣逼人)
看板AndroidDev
標題[問題] fragment 穿透
時間Mon Oct 17 15:59:51 2016
我activity上面有點擊事件
當我activity上面有一層fragment
Fragment上有按鈕
按下去會replace到另外一頁fragment
但若我快速點擊fragment上的btn時
都會觸發activity上的點擊事件
Clickable true跟onTaouch都試過了
他們主要是針對兩層的fragment
但我是在relace的過程中會觸發到下面的點擊事件
請問該何解
我試過在activity add一層遮罩用的fragment
但依然無效
感謝解惑
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 101.9.98.25
※ 文章網址: https://www.ptt.cc/bbs/AndroidDev/M.1476691193.A.0C8.html
→ corrupt003: 1. 擋快速click 2. fragment layout全螢幕 10/17 17:13
→ lonelytea: 以上都不行..目前看來改成add可改善 但這樣需要修改了 10/17 17:35
→ lonelytea: 流程的判斷..QQ 10/17 17:35
→ ssccg: replace的地方直接換成add然後postDelay remove呢 10/17 18:03
→ marfha: fragment 的容器設成clicable true? 10/17 19:31
→ htury: 有fragment時,在activity疊個透明的view,這樣click也沒差 10/18 02:32
→ lonelytea: 感謝 最後我是用樓上的方式 10/18 23:49
推 fightmz: 我也是設成clickable true 10/21 21:04